WebJan 27, 2024 · Born Jason Jeffery Gay in 1972 in Minneapolis, Gray (his chosen stage name since 2005) grew up in a musical family and often traveled with his mother, who played in a band. In the early '80s, his parents divorced and his mother became a Christian, moving from rock clubs to the revival circuit. (2007) Everything Sad Is Coming Untrue. (2009) A Way to See in the Dark. (2011) Everything Sad Is Coming Untrue is a music album by Jason Gray released September 1, 2009. It is his seventh solo record and his second major label national release with Centricity Music. It was produced by Jason Ingram and Rusty Varencamp.
